Cooking Instructions
- Pat the chicken breasts dry and season both sides evenly with salt, pepper, and paprika.
- In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ium-high heat. Add the seasoned chicken breasts and cook for 4-5 minutes on each side until they’re golden brown and nearly cooked through. Remove from the pan and set aside.
- In the same skillet, melt butter over medium heat and add the minced garlic. Sauté for about 30 seconds until fragrant.
- Stir in the honey, soy sauce, and apple cider vinegar. Simmer for 1-2 minutes until it thickens slightly.
- Return the seared chicken to the skillet. Coat thoroughly with the honey garlic sauce and cook for an additional 3-5 minutes until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(75°C).
- Remove from heat and garnish with fresh parsley or sesame seeds before serving.

Notes
Serve over jasmine rice or with a side of steamed vegetables for a complete meal.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container for up to 4 days.
